Pakalavaripalle
Pakalavaripalle is a village in Chandragiri, Tirupati district, Andhra Pradesh. Pakalavaripalle is situated nearby to the hamlet Amasavaripalle, as well as near Patapeta.Places in the Area

Pakala is a town in Tirupati district of the Indian state of Andhra Pradesh. It is the mandal headquarters of Pakala mandal. It comes under Tirupati revenue division. Pakala is situated 9 km southwest of Pakalavaripalle.
